There is a new option on the horizon.....

Yesterday I was in a bikeshop that sells cruisers and town/commuter
bikes. They carry all the Electra bikes and as part of the Ticino line
of bikes they make now, have released a copy of the Nitto Touring
Cage, I bought one for $20 and its an identical copy of the nitto
cage. and for $20 I thought what the hell. They call it their  ticino
tourist cage.

Its a nice option these days.

you guys should check out Electra's website for the whole range of
components from the Tourist line. TA style cranks, TA style pedals, C-
Record style hubs. and a lot more. Nice looking stuff, just not sure
of the durability factor.
